Monitoring the Heterogeneous Reaction of LiH and LiOH with H<sub>2</sub>O and CO<sub>2</sub> by Diffuse Reflectance Infrared Fourier Transform Spectroscopy

Measurement of the reaction of water vapor and carbon dioxide with lithium compounds such as LiH and LiOH has been carried out in situ using diffuse reflectance infrared Fourier transform (DRIFT) Spectroscopy. The bakeable high-vacuum cell, based on a modification of a commercial diffuse reflectance infrared cell is described along with means for controlling the gaseous and thermal environment.
